- Begin with understanding the various pricing models employed by ad networks.
Common examples include cost-per-click (CPC), cost-per-impression (CPM), and cost-per-acquisition (CPA). Each model works differently and suits specific advertising objectives.
- Subsequently, we'll delve into the factors that affect ad pricing. These include industry competitiveness, targeting parameters, campaign timeframe, and advertiser reputation.
- Finally, we'll provide useful tips on how to optimize your ad campaigns for maximum return. This includes strategies for bidding, budgeting, and analyzing your outcomes.
